Gravel roof repair services involve inspecting and fixing issues that can develop over time on gravel-covered roofing systems. This type of roof typically consists of a layer of gravel or small stones spread over a protective membrane or underlying materials. When problems arise, experienced service providers assess the condition of the gravel layer, identify areas of damage or wear, and perform repairs to restore the roof’s integrity. This process may include replacing damaged gravel, patching leaks, or reinforcing weak spots to prevent further deterioration and extend the roof's lifespan.

Common problems that gravel roof repair helps address include loose or displaced gravel, cracks in the underlying membrane, ponding water, and leaks. Over time, gravel can shift or wash away, exposing the underlying materials to weather damage. Cracks or tears in the membrane can lead to water infiltration, especially during heavy rain or snow. Repairing these issues promptly can prevent more costly damage inside the building and maintain the roof’s protective function. Skilled contractors use specialized techniques to ensure repairs are durable and that the gravel layer remains properly distributed to provide effective coverage.

Many types of properties utilize gravel roofing, particularly commercial buildings, warehouses, and industrial facilities. These roofs are often chosen for their durability, fire resistance, and cost-effectiveness. However, they are also found on some residential structures, especially those with flat or low-slope roofs. The overview below groups typical Gravel Roof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Absecon, NJ.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or gravel roof repairs in Absecon often range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es fall within this band, covering patching, sealing, or small section replacements. Fewer projects extend into higher price ranges unless additional work is needed.

Moderate Repairs - More extensive repairs, such as replacing larger sections or addressing multiple issues, usually cost between $600 and $2,000. These projects are common for mid-sized roofs or multiple problem areas needing attention by local contractors.

Full Roof Replacement - Complete gravel roof replacements in the area typically range from $4,000 to $8,000. Larger, more complex projects can sometimes reach $10,000 or more, especially if additional work or materials are required.

Complex or Large-Scale Projects - Very large or intricate gravel roof repairs and replacements can exceed $10,000, depending on the scope and specifics of the project. Such jobs are less common but handled by local pros for clients with extensive or challenging roofing need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that a gravel roof needs repair? Signs include pooling water, cracked or loose gravel, visible leaks, and damaged or worn areas on the surface of the roof.

Can gravel roof repairs be handled without replacing the entire roof? Yes, many repairs involve patching damaged sections, resealing leaks, or replacing worn gravel, which can extend the roof's lifespan without full replacement.

What types of issues can local contractors fix on gravel roofs? They can address leaks, ponding water, gravel displacement, surface cracks, and damaged flashing or edging components.

Are gravel roof repairs suitable for all types of buildings? Gravel roof repairs are generally suitable for commercial, industrial, and some residential flat roof structures that utilize gravel surfacing.
